Limited-Edition T-Series Black Irons Launched by Titleist

Titleist recently announced the release of their T-Series irons in a new black finish, made of titanium carbide vapor. This new finish is smudge-resistant and adds a unique flair to the already popular T-Series irons. The black finish is available on all four models of the T-Series – T100, T150, T200, and T350. Professional golfer Cameron Smith, who won the 2022 Open Championship, was among the first to use the black finish on his T-Series irons, opting for a blended set with T100 scoring irons and T150 5-iron. The blended set offers a balance of performance and forgiveness throughout the bag, helping players achieve better results on the course.

Each model of the T-Series Black irons features the same titanium carbide vapor finish, creating a seamless look for players with blended sets. The smudge-resistant nature of the finish allows players to use their T-Series black irons for a longer period before showing signs of wear and tear. This durability is a major benefit for players considering the switch to the black finish. The new T-Series Black irons are currently available for pre-sale and will be available in retail stores on February 28th. The cost of each iron is $271, or $1,899 for a seven-piece set, making them an affordable option for players looking to upgrade their irons.
